Dr. Natasha Archer specializes in oncology with focused training in pediatric hematology and oncology. She completed her medical education at Yale University School of Medicine and pursued a combined residency in internal medicine and pediatrics at Brigham and Women's Hospital and Boston Children's Hospital. Dr. Archer further advanced her expertise through a fellowship in pediatric hematology and oncology at Boston Children's Hospital and Dana-Farber Cancer Institute. She holds certification in internal medicine from the American Board of Internal Medicine and is fluent in English.

Dr. Archer practices at Dana-Farber Cancer Institute in Boston, Massachusetts, with hospital affiliations at Boston Children's Hospital. She has particular expertise in treating sickle cell disease and related blood disorders, including managing sickle cell crises. Her clinical work includes performing comprehensive blood evaluations through complete blood counts and reticulocyte counts, as well as metabolic assessments to monitor patient health and treatment response.
